Which way this market is moving
Active inventory across Hillsborough County has fallen over the past year (-8%). About 31% of county listings currently carry a price cut, which tells you how much negotiating room the average seller has already conceded. Beacon Meadows itself has appreciated about 0% over the period Momentum’s MLS data tracks — a community-level trend, not the county average. A strong local agent will reconcile these numbers with what is happening on your exact street before recommending a price.
What it costs to own in Beacon Meadows
On a median-priced Beacon Meadows home ($410,000), property taxes at Hillsborough County’s typical millage of 15.7279 run roughly $5,662 a year with the homestead exemption applied — before any CDD or special-district charges, which vary by community.
The average Citizens Property Insurance premium in Hillsborough County is about $1,816 a year (April 2026 filings); private-market quotes differ, and a good agent will tell you which carriers are actually writing here.

Rents and the investor math
Typical asking rent across Hillsborough County sits near $2,024 a month (Zillow’s rent index). Rents are moving about -1.1% year over year. County-level yield math pencils to roughly a 6.39% cap rate on typical numbers, before expenses. Home prices run about 5.07x the county’s median household income, the affordability backdrop every buyer here negotiates inside. If you are weighing an investment purchase in Beacon Meadows, ask your agent for community-level rent comps rather than county averages — the spread between communities is wide.
Who is moving to Hillsborough County, and what they earn
The county lost a net 1,186 people in the latest IRS county-migration year. Households moving IN average $77,979 in income versus $72,366 for those moving out — movers arriving here earn more than those leaving, which shapes what sellers can ask and what buyers compete against. The biggest out-of-state feeder markets are NY, TX, NJ. Median household income in Hillsborough County has grown about 34% since 2018 ($75,011 now). Population is up about 8% over the same stretch. An agent who knows these flows can tell you which way demand in Beacon Meadows is actually pointing, not just where prices have been.
Sources: IRS SOI county-to-county migration; U.S. Census income and population estimates. County-level data for context; community demand varies within the county.

Questions to ask before you hire a Beacon Meadows agent
- How many homes have you sold in or near Beacon Meadows in the last year?
- How will you price my home (or help me bid), and what comps are you using?
- What’s your marketing plan, and where will my home actually show up?
- How do you handle negotiations, inspections, and appraisal gaps?
- How and how often will you communicate with me?
- Can you share recent client references?
